Is There Single Player In Big Walk?
Though a solo player in Big Walk can host a game for their friends to join, there's no single-player mode at the time of publishing this guide. The only real way to play Big Walk by yourself is to have multiple copies of the game on different households and be willing to do each part of each puzzle as two players instead of one.

Big Walk normally costs $19.99 USD across all its platforms (PC, Mac, PS5, and Switch 2). However, as of the time of writing, there is a launch discount happening until August 18 that drops the game's price to $14.99. You can also get it for no additional charge if you're a current subscriber to the PlayStation Plus Essential tier.
